EPFL, the Swiss Federal Institute of Technology in Lausanne, is one of the most dynamic university campuses in Europe, employing more than 6,500 individuals. The campus supports education, research, and innovation and is home to over 12,500 students and 4,000 researchers from more than 120 different countries.
OPTIION is an early-stage startup based at the Distributed Electrical Systems Laboratory (DESL) at EPFL, focused on developing software for battery owners to optimize operations across energy markets. The company plays a role in the energy transition, enabling cost-effective deployment of renewable energy sources.
